About EESAC

By an act of the Florida Legislature, each school must have an Educational Excellence School Advisory Council (EESAC) composed of parents (elected by parents), teachers (elected by teachers), support staff (elected by support staff), a student (elected by students), the principal, and local business and community leaders appointed by the principal. A majority of the committee members must not be employed by the school. All interested community members are encouraged to attend EESAC meetings even if they are not voting members of the council.

The EESAC is responsible for developing and making final decisions about the School Improvement Plan (SIP), which addresses issues such as curriculum, budget, discipline, training, instructional materials, technology, staffing and student support services. The EESAC also advises the principal on the development of the school’s budget.

Even if you do not wish to become an EESAC representative, you should get to know the parents who are. Ask them what issues the EESAC is discussing, find out where to get copies of the minutes and actions, and feel free to make comments and suggestions on the topics that concern you.
